A new patent filing shows Apple exploring portable multi-touch skins that can be wrapped around three-dimensional objects, according to an AppleInsider report.

Apple notes that on notebooks touchpads and touch screens similar to the iPhone, the user moves one or more fingers on a two-dimensional surface to operate the device.

"However, for the operation of many devices, it is desirable, preferable or even necessary for the user to move his or her fingers over a three-dimensional surface," the filing states. "This is directed to a multi-touch skin placed along three dimensions of an object. A single multi-touch skin can be configured to span all three dimensions or two or more multi-touch skins can be used to span the three dimensions."

iMobileCinema is a MobileSafari plugin which allows for playback of Flash (flv) video on the iPhone. You can watch videos from podcast sites or blogs with it; such as, Google Video, Youtube, and others.

A beta version of iMobileCinema has just been released for 2.x iPhones and can be installed via Cydia. You will need to add the d.imobilecinema.com source first.
